Loading the Print Media

Loading a Tube or Plate

IMPORTANT
• Do not use the following types of tubes. Not only will the product not print cleanly, but use with such
tubes may also cause a malfunction.
- Broken
- Crushed
- Soiled
- Uneven
• You cannot print on dirty tubes or plates. Wipe off any dirt or dust with a dry cloth. Also, do not use
tubes or plates that have oil or other stains that cannot be wiped off.

1
Prepare the attachment.
For tubes (round)
Use the cleaner (blue) by attaching it to the tube attachment.
For flat tubes
Use the cleaner (blue) by attaching it to the (optional) plate and flat tube attachment.
